Nurix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:NRIX) stock is up during Monday’s premarket session as the company collaborates with Roche Holdings AG (OTC:RHHBY) to co-develop and co-commercialize bexobrutideg, an investigational Bruton’s Tyrosine Kinase (BTK) degrader.
The partnership aims to enhance treatment options for patients with B-cell malignancies, a sector projected to grow significantly, with the combined market expected to reach $41 billion by 2031.
The collaboration with Roche will focus on bexobrutideg, which is set to enter Phase 3 clinical trials for treating ch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) in the summer of 2026.
The partnership is seen as a strategic move to leverage Roche’s strengths in hematology and expand Nurix’s pipeline into immunology and neurology.
Deal Terms
Under the terms of the agreement, Nurix will receive an upfront cash payment of $700 million and is eligible to receive development, regulatory, and sales milestones for a potential total deal value of up to $2.3 billion.
Development costs will be shared 40% by Nurix and 60% by Roche. The parties will equally split the profits and losses from U.S. commercialization.
Nurix and Roche will co-commercialize bexobrutide in the U.S. across all indications.
Outside the U.S., Roche will be responsible for commercialization, with Nurix receiving royalties ranging from the low to high teens.
